What Is an Oracle in Blockchain?

1/20/2023, 9:33:49 AM
Beginner
Blockchain
An oracle in blockchain technology is a third-party service that provides external data to a smart contract, allowing it to interact with the real world.

Since their creation, blockchains have created a trillion-dollar ecosystem, mostly based on cryptocurrencies, but the way they were designed naturally has some limitations. Blockchains aren’t able to collect external data, also known as off-chain data. Without collecting it, they would be very limited on what they could execute and support, and that’s where Oracles take place.

Blockchain oracles are third-party entities that deliver relevant outside information to smart contracts in a decentralized finance system, providing them with accurate insights to be safely executed.

What Is an Oracle in Blockchain?

Just as the name suggests, an oracle is an external entity from a system that brings insights into a blockchain, based on relevant information available on the world outside the scope of that network. It is a very valuable service because it allows for external links to be made in order to help smart contracts to run smoothly. Basically, it connects inputs and outputs of data. That is a necessity because blockchains and smart contracts are unable to access off-chain information, even though that can be vital to the proper execution of the terms in a contract.

In Decentralized Finance, the use of smart contracts - digital agreements, programmed to automatically activate according to the parameters set - is very common, and the existence of a computational service capable of bringing together both the reliability of the blockchain with relevant outside information, is a very powerful prospect.

Blockchain oracles help broaden the way smart contracts are able to function, in a more realistic way. While they are not the original source of data, they work as a layer in-between the chains and the external data, relaying the authenticated information. Within the network the data flow is very thorough, secure and vast, but it is not sensitive enough to attend to the new information influx coming about with everyday life.

Types of Blockchain Oracles

Where Blockchain can at times be considered a self-contained system, limited only to the information contained within, the use of oracles is able to fulfill most information gaps within the chains, enabling fast access to multiple different types of data, news and computational power. How this type of technology will ultimately operate depends mostly on what it is designed to do, and what is its relevance to the smart contracts and blockchain data it supports.

In a nutshell, oracles are capable of expanding decentralized digital contracts by providing the blockchain with extra data resources, without altering its original characteristics or impacting the validity protocols in place. In order to fulfill the large amount of data resources it can acquire, they may vary in type, depending on the function they could have.:

Input Oracles

This type of oracle is the most widely used today. Input oracles gather off-chain data and then input it onto a blockchain network to inform smart contracts, usually providing them with on-chain access to information from the financial market.

Output Oracles

Output oracles are the opposite of input ones, meaning that instead of acquiring and distributing information from outside in, they take an order from inside out. Through that, smart contracts are capable of sending orders to off-chain systems, for instance: to allow payments, asking for certain services to be provided, or even aiding in logistics matters.

Compute-Enabled Oracles

Compute-Enabled oracles are becoming quite popular in blockchain. They use off-chain computational power to provide on-chain services that for many reasons would not be easy to implement otherwise. These oracles can be applied in automation of smart contracts, data analysis and privacy, as well as cybersecurity.

Cross-Chain Oracles

This type of oracles is capable of writing and interpreting information between different blockchains, lending a better range of interoperability between two networks, helping to move assets and data, as well as creating triggers in-between both systems that may be triggered by certain actions.


Source: Chainlink

Oracles use cases

The use of this technology has potential to be applied over many different fields, and for multiple purposes. A few good examples of fields that rely on oracles, and their uses are:

  • NFTs: One of the most famous uses of oracles is in the NFT field, generating randomness, selecting winners in drops and creating a more unpredictable game play;

  • Decentralized Finance (DeFi): Accessing financial information, assessing borrowing capacity and estimating the value of an asset according to others;

  • Business management and IT: through oracles, companies are able to quickly and efficiently connect to blockchains as well as implement improvements and adapt it to their goals;

  • Insurance: through IoT, oracles are able to verify insurable claims, run background checks and verify payment abilities of a client.

Another trend that is very much becoming a reality is the Internet of Things and the Multiverse. It brings about both a strong sense of excitement, as well as many concerns about data privacy, user and company security, as well as the need for useful products. Oracles can very much help on that front, by expanding the security of the block through inter-exchangeability and creating automated smart contracts that are both fast and focus on the needs of its users.

Oracles also have a great potential in aiding in the diminishing of bureaucracy in transactions that are often time-consuming, like waiting on loan approvals from financial institutions, intercommunication between decentralized finance systems and the traditional banking system and also creating self-service solutions that do not rely on a costly customer service structure.

Conclusion

The problem of finding ways to both expand and improve communications between a blockchain network and the off-chain reality is a strong concern in regards to this technology. Blockchain points to being the future of data, and innovation is a constant in this field.

Oracles show to be efficient in bridging that gap and lending more safety and functionality, expanding networks and lending interactivity to a system once thought to be shut-in. If blockchain technology is able to acquire mass adoption in the next few years, part of the credits should be given to the advent of Oracles in the system.

Author: Piccolo
Translator: .
Reviewer(s): Hugo, Edward, Cecilia
* The information is not intended to be and does not constitute financial advice or any other recommendation of any sort offered or endorsed by Gate.
* This article may not be reproduced, transmitted or copied without referencing Gate. Contravention is an infringement of Copyright Act and may be subject to legal action.

Share

Crypto Calendar

Project Updates
Etherex will launch the token REX on August 6.
REX
22.27%
2025-08-06
Rare Dev & Governance Day in Las Vegas
Cardano will host the Rare Dev & Governance Day in Las Vegas, from August 6 to 7, featuring workshops, hackathons and panel discussions focused on technical development and governance topics.
ADA
-3.44%
2025-08-06
Blockchain.Rio in Rio De Janeiro
Stellar will participate in the Blockchain.Rio conference, scheduled to be held in Rio de Janeiro, from August 5 to 7. The program will include keynotes and panel discussions featuring representatives of the Stellar ecosystem in collaboration with partners Cheesecake Labs and NearX.
XLM
-3.18%
2025-08-06
Webinar
Circle has announced a live Executive Insights webinar titled “The GENIUS Act Era Begins”, scheduled for August 7, 2025, at 14:00 UTC. The session will explore the implications of the newly passed GENIUS Act—the first federal regulatory framework for payment stablecoins in the United States. Circle’s Dante Disparte and Corey Then will lead the discussion on how the legislation impacts digital asset innovation, regulatory clarity, and the US’s leadership in global financial infrastructure.
USDC
-0.03%
2025-08-06
AMA on X
Ankr will host an AMA on X on August 7th at 16:00 UTC, focusing on DogeOS’s work in building the application layer for DOGE.
ANKR
-3.23%
2025-08-06

Related Articles

Solana Need L2s And Appchains?
Advanced

Solana Need L2s And Appchains?

Solana faces both opportunities and challenges in its development. Recently, severe network congestion has led to a high transaction failure rate and increased fees. Consequently, some have suggested using Layer 2 and appchain technologies to address this issue. This article explores the feasibility of this strategy.
6/24/2024, 1:39:17 AM
The Future of Cross-Chain Bridges: Full-Chain Interoperability Becomes Inevitable, Liquidity Bridges Will Decline
Beginner

The Future of Cross-Chain Bridges: Full-Chain Interoperability Becomes Inevitable, Liquidity Bridges Will Decline

This article explores the development trends, applications, and prospects of cross-chain bridges.
12/27/2023, 7:44:05 AM
Sui: How are users leveraging its speed, security, & scalability?
Intermediate

Sui: How are users leveraging its speed, security, & scalability?

Sui is a PoS L1 blockchain with a novel architecture whose object-centric model enables parallelization of transactions through verifier level scaling. In this research paper the unique features of the Sui blockchain will be introduced, the economic prospects of SUI tokens will be presented, and it will be explained how investors can learn about which dApps are driving the use of the chain through the Sui application campaign.
6/13/2024, 8:23:51 AM
Navigating the Zero Knowledge Landscape
Advanced

Navigating the Zero Knowledge Landscape

This article introduces the technical principles, framework, and applications of Zero-Knowledge (ZK) technology, covering aspects from privacy, identity (ID), decentralized exchanges (DEX), to oracles.
1/4/2024, 4:01:13 PM
What Is Ethereum 2.0? Understanding The Merge
Intermediate

What Is Ethereum 2.0? Understanding The Merge

A change in one of the top cryptocurrencies that might impact the whole ecosystem
1/18/2023, 2:25:24 PM
What is Tronscan and How Can You Use it in 2025?
Beginner

What is Tronscan and How Can You Use it in 2025?

Tronscan is a blockchain explorer that goes beyond the basics, offering wallet management, token tracking, smart contract insights, and governance participation. By 2025, it has evolved with enhanced security features, expanded analytics, cross-chain integration, and improved mobile experience. The platform now includes advanced biometric authentication, real-time transaction monitoring, and a comprehensive DeFi dashboard. Developers benefit from AI-powered smart contract analysis and improved testing environments, while users enjoy a unified multi-chain portfolio view and gesture-based navigation on mobile devices.
5/22/2025, 3:13:17 AM
Start Now
Sign up and get a
$100
Voucher!